Prostaglandins, cyclic AMP and the biochemical mechanism of opiate agonist action.
Authors:A C Roy  H O Collier
Institution:Research Department, Miles Laboratories Limited, Stoke Poges, Slough SL2 4LY, England
Abstract:The paper re-examines, in the light of recent evidence, the original proposition that the ability of opiates to inhibit the stimulation by E prostaglandins of cyclic AMP formation in rat brain homogenate represents a biochemical mechanism that could account for the analgesic and allied effects of these drugs. It is concluded that subsequent evidence largely supports the original proposition; but that this can now be made more definite. It is proposed that inhibition of an adenylate cyclase of morphine-sensitive neurones is the decisive biochemical consequence of the binding of an opiate agonist with its specific receptor.
